To secure your external drives and backup hardware at home, store them in lockable cabinets or hidden locations and limit physical access. Use strong passwords and encrypt your data to protect against cyber threats. Consider installing alarms or security tags to deter theft. Automate backup processes and regularly verify data integrity. Why External Drives Are Vulnerable and Why Security Matters

External drives are vulnerable because they are often physically accessible and less protected than internal storage, making them easy targets for theft, loss, or tampering. If someone gains physical access, they could copy or delete your data easily. Additionally, remote access features or cloud synchronization can expose your files to cyber threats if not properly secured. Hackers might exploit vulnerabilities in remote access setups to infiltrate your backups. Without proper encryption or strong passwords, your sensitive information becomes at risk. External drives also lack built-in security layers, so safeguarding them is vital. Protecting your backup hardware involves understanding these vulnerabilities and implementing measures to minimize risks, ensuring your data remains safe from both physical and digital threats. Implement Theft Deterrents
To effectively deter theft, it’s essential to implement physical security measures that make your external backup drives less attractive to potential thieves. Use alarm systems to alert you immediately if someone tampers with your hardware. Security signage can serve as a visual warning, discouraging theft before it happens. You can also lock drives in secure cabinets or attach them to sturdy furniture to prevent quick snatches. Consider placing visible alarm sensors near your backup equipment. The table below highlights key theft deterrents:
| Strategy | Implementation | Effect |
|---|---|---|
| Alarm Systems | Install motion-activated alarms | Immediate alerts, deter theft |
| Security Signage | Place warning signs around | Discourages potential thieves |
| Physical Locks | Use lockable enclosures or cables | Prevents easy removal |

Choose Reliable Backup Storage Solutions

Selecting a reliable backup storage solution is essential to guarantee your data remains safe and accessible when you need it most. You want options that guarantee data redundancy, so even if one fails, your information stays protected. Cloud storage offers scalable, off-site backups accessible from anywhere, making it a flexible choice. For physical solutions, consider external drives with built-in encryption and high durability. Combining local and cloud storage creates a robust backup strategy, reducing risks of data loss. Look for providers with strong security measures, reliable uptime, and good customer support. Also, verify that your backup hardware supports automatic backups and versioning, preventing overwrites and securing data integrity. Choosing the right mix of storage options keeps your backups safe, accessible, and resilient.
Automate Your Backups and Monitor Data Integrity

Automating your backups guarantees your data stays current without requiring manual effort, reducing the risk of forgetting or delaying essential updates. Set up automatic backups with tools that support cloud synchronization, ensuring your files are securely uploaded to the cloud regularly. This keeps your data accessible and protected even if your hardware fails. Implement hardware redundancy by using multiple external drives or backup systems that mirror each other, so if one fails, your data remains safe. To monitor data integrity, use software that regularly checks for errors or corruption, alerting you to any issues early. Automating these processes frees you from constant oversight while maintaining consistent, reliable backups. This proactive approach helps safeguard your data against loss or damage, giving you peace of mind.
Protect Yourself From Cyber Attacks and Physical Theft

While automating backups keeps your data safe from hardware failures, it’s equally important to safeguard your information against cyber threats and physical theft. To protect yourself, consider enabling cloud synchronization for real-time updates and remote access, reducing the risk of losing data if your physical drives are stolen. Implement data redundancy by storing copies across multiple locations, so a single breach or theft doesn’t compromise everything. Use strong, unique passwords and enable two-factor authentication on your backup accounts. Keep your software and security tools updated to prevent vulnerabilities. Finally, store external drives in secure, hidden locations at home to deter physical theft. Taking these steps guarantees your data remains protected from both cyberattacks and physical threats.

Can Cloud Backups Replace Physical External Drives Securely?
Cloud backups can be secure if you use strong encryption protocols and strict access controls. They often offer automatic updates and remote access, making them convenient. However, you should guarantee your cloud provider encrypts data both in transit and at rest. Combine this with multi-factor authentication to improve security. While cloud backups are a solid alternative, maintaining physical external drives with proper security measures remains a reliable option for thorough protection.

How Do I Securely Dispose of Old Backup Hardware?
To securely dispose of old backup hardware, start by erasing all data using robust data encryption tools to prevent recovery. Then, physically destroy the hardware with hardware shredding or degaussing to make certain data cannot be retrieved. This combination of data encryption and hardware shredding guarantees your sensitive information remains protected, and the hardware can’t be reused or tampered with, maintaining your data security and privacy.
